AP-64, Encoded by <i>C5orf46</i>, Exhibits Antimicrobial Activity against Gram-Negative Bacteria
Antimicrobial peptides (AMPs), which are evolutionarily conserved components of the innate immune response, contribute to the first line of defense against microbes in the skin and at mucosal surfaces.
